Основы функционирования PowerShell
PowerShell образует собой инструмент терминальной оболочки и среду скриптов, созданный для оптимизации операций а-также администрирования системой. Он используется ради проведения инструкций, конфигурации операционной платформы, обслуживания компонентов плюс анализа сведений. Во разницу по-сравнению-с традиционных командных оболочек, PowerShell-среда функционирует не-исключительно лишь через строками, однако и со объектами, это расширяет возможности 1xbet обработки и контроля.
Во современных системах PowerShell-среда применяется ради облегчения регулярных операций и разработки автоматизированных скриптов. В прикладных материалах а-также практических случаях, среди-них 1xbet скачать, часто показывается, каким-образом с помощью PowerShell возможно управлять каталогами, операциями и сетевыми конфигурациями без-применения задействования визуального UI.
Главные принципы работы PowerShell-среды
PowerShell основан на концепции встроенных-команд — служебных системных инструкций, отдельная в-числе них проводит конкретную задачу. Cmdlet-команды имеют типовую схему имен, чаще-всего построенную на-основе глагола и объекта. Такой подход делает операции более ясными плюс последовательными.
Любой командлет возвращает результат, при-этом не-просто текстовую вывод. Это указывает, когда результат можно отправлять во следующие команды без-применения дополнительной проверки. Данный принцип позволяет формировать цепочки команд, во которых объекты последовательно обрабатываются разными командами.
Использование во PowerShell-среде формируется вокруг поэтапного выполнения инструкций. Администратор либо командный-файл определяет действия, после-чего система выполняет операции согласно определенном порядке. За-счет данному-подходу возможно создавать сценарии, которые без-ручного-участия выполняют развитые процессы без-ручного человеческого участия 1хбет.
Встроенные-команды и их формат
Cmdlet-команды являются базой PowerShell. Такие-команды имеют общий формат именования, допустим Get-Process, Set-Location либо Remove-Item. Первая-часть показывает действие, и существительное указывает ресурс, над которым данное действие запускается.
Cmdlet-команды способны принимать параметры, они конкретизируют сценарий выполнения. К-примеру, реально передать определенный документ, каталог а-также процесс. Аргументы дают-возможность адаптировать 1xbet зеркало инструкцию под-конкретную точную операцию плюс делают процесс значительно гибкой.
Итог запуска cmdlet-команды реально записать в переменную-область либо передать далее через цепочке. Подобная-возможность позволяет сочетать инструкции плюс разрабатывать более сложные скрипты, построенные на-основе нескольких этапов.
Взаимодействие с данными
Одной из важных характеристик PowerShell-среды выступает взаимодействие со данными. В-отличие отличие по-сравнению-с классических сред, в-которых операции возвращают символы, PowerShell передает упорядоченные данные. Отдельный объект имеет свойства а-также операции, они возможно задействовать ради следующей передачи.
К-примеру, во-время получении списка служб PowerShell выдает не просто строки при обозначениями, при-этом структуры со данными касательно каждом 1xbet объекте. Такой-подход помогает отбирать, сортировать а-также корректировать информацию без-необходимости дополнительных операций.
Работа через структурами оптимизирует изучение сведений и создает цепочки более точными. Можно выбирать только требуемые свойства, выполнять сопоставления плюс задействовать условия без-применения трудных манипуляций со символами.
Цепочка Windows-PowerShell
Pipeline дает-возможность передавать итог первой команды в следующую. Данный-механизм один в-числе ключевых инструментов PowerShell. С его использованием можно связывать несколько командлетов в общую последовательность, когда отдельная инструкция проверяет объекты, полученные из предыдущей.
Данный принцип формирует цепочки лаконичными плюс ясными. Без подготовки временных результатов или значений возможно сразу направлять вывод дальше. Такой-формат ускоряет проведение действий и сокращает риск 1хбет ошибок.
Pipeline регулярно задействуется во-время отбора объектов, подборе требуемых записей плюс запуске связанных действий. Pipeline является значимой основой структуры работы PowerShell-среды.
Контейнеры и сохранение данных
Значения для PowerShell задействуются с-целью сохранения информации, она имеет-возможность быть задействована впоследствии. Переменные обозначаются знаком $ плюс способны включать несколько форматы информации, содержа строки, числа, массивы плюс элементы.
Задействование значений позволяет фиксировать служебные выводы плюс оптимизирует процесс при развитыми сценариями. Без дублирующего выполнения той-же а-также данной же инструкции реально зафиксировать результат и задействовать результат еще-раз.
Значения дополнительно дают-возможность структурировать сценарий а-также создают код намного читаемым. Такая-возможность особенно необходимо 1xbet зеркало при подготовке больших цепочек, где нужно обрабатывать большим-количеством данных.
Командные-файлы в Windows-PowerShell
PowerShell-среда поддерживает создание скриптов — файлов с расширением .ps1, хранящих набор операций. Командные-файлы позволяют ускорить процессы плюс проводить их регулярно без прямого набора.
Скрипты имеют-возможность охватывать проверки, циклы плюс методы. Такой-набор делает их самостоятельным механизмом для закрытия развитых процессов. Сценарии используются для настройки систем, анализа информации плюс запуска регулярных операций.
До запуском командных-файлов важно учитывать правила безопасности системы. Windows-PowerShell 1xbet имеет-возможность ограничивать выполнение скриптов для защиты для-предотвращения нежелательного ПО. Из-за-этого нужно корректно настраивать политики плюс использовать исключительно надежные скрипты.
Селекция и анализ информации
Windows-PowerShell дает механизмы ради фильтрации и преобразования данных. С-помощью их помощью реально выбирать только требуемые объекты, распределять элементы плюс проводить различные процессы.
Селекция помогает уменьшить количество сведений плюс сконцентрироваться на-важных значимых объектах. Такая-возможность 1хбет особенно актуально при взаимодействии при крупными списками процессов или объектов.
Анализ информации может включать изменение видов, соединение значений и запуск вычислений. Подобные процессы обычно задействуются в оптимизации а-также аналитике.
Операции со каталогами плюс системой
PowerShell-среда регулярно задействуется с-целью администрирования файлами а-также папками. С-помощью PowerShell помощью реально формировать, стирать, перемещать плюс редактировать документы. Также реально просматривать контент папок 1xbet зеркало плюс выполнять сканирование.
Помимо операций со данными, PowerShell дает-возможность управлять процессами, процессами и параметрами системы. Данный-фактор создает его универсальным средством с-целью обслуживания.
Сценарии имеют-возможность без-ручного-участия выполнять запасное сохранение, чистить кэшированные файлы и контролировать изменения внутри системе. Это позволяет поддерживать порядок а-также корректность работы.
Дистанционное контроль
PowerShell-среда поддерживает удаленное выполнение команд. Данный-механизм помогает управлять удаленными узлами а-также системами без-прямого прямого подключения с ним. Данный механизм регулярно используется во 1xbet бизнес средах.
Удаленное управление дает-возможность проводить операции с-одного-узла. Допустим, возможно модифицировать программное ПО на-множестве нескольких компьютерах сразу либо оценить их.
Для-работы внутри удаленном режиме-работы используются защитные инструменты и настройки безопасности. Такая-система создает сохранность данных плюс управление прав.
Контроль Windows-PowerShell
Windows-PowerShell содержит инструменты контроля, которые контролируют запуск сценариев. Это необходимо для защиты-от исполнения опасных сценариев. Система может проверять цифровую подтверждение либо разрешение на исполнение скриптов.
Критично контролировать политику защиты при работе с PowerShell-средой. Не-рекомендуется 1хбет выполнять сомнительные скрипты плюс редактировать параметры без-оценки понимания последствий.
Мониторинг разрешений а-также анализ файлов позволяют сократить риски и создают устойчивую функционирование системы. Корректное применение Windows-PowerShell считается значимой основой администрирования.
Реальное использование PowerShell-среды
Windows-PowerShell применяется внутри многочисленных областях, включая администрирование, программирование и изучение сведений. Он дает-возможность ускорять задачи, контролировать 1xbet зеркало средами и анализировать сведения.
С-помощью PowerShell использованием реально создавать отчеты, подготавливать окружение, контролировать учетными-записями а-также запускать развитые операции. Это делает PowerShell-среду универсальным средством для управления с системой.
Адаптивность плюс расширяемость дают-возможность настраивать PowerShell-среду под-конкретные точные сценарии. Он выступает актуальным решением внутри нынешних цифровых инфраструктурах.
Расширенные возможности плюс дополнения
Windows-PowerShell позволяет увеличение инструментов посредством использование расширений. Расширение представляет собой совокупность встроенных-команд, процедур а-также ресурсов, связанных внутри единый пакет. Посредством расширений использованием возможно внедрять новые функции без перестройки основной среды. К-примеру, существуют расширения с-целью взаимодействия с удаленными сервисами, хранилищами информации 1xbet а-также сетевыми инструментами.
Импорт модулей помогает применять расширенные команды так-же же просто, подобно стандартные средства. Данный-подход формирует PowerShell настраиваемым а-также расширяемым под-конкретные разные сценарии. Администраторы и программисты имеют-возможность создавать собственные пакеты, они подходят конкретным условиям системы.
Дополнительно Windows-PowerShell позволяет ведение записей а-также логирование. Скрипты имеют-возможность фиксировать информацию касательно запуске, записывать исключения а-также сохранять результаты команд. Такая-функция необходимо с-целью оценки, отладки и мониторинга операций. Логи позволяют понять, какие действия проводились плюс в какой 1хбет цепочке.
Исключения плюс их обработка
В-процессе работе через сценариями способны возникать сбои, связанные из-за разрешениями, недоступностью документов либо некорректными аргументами. PowerShell-среда предоставляет инструменты контроля данных ситуаций. Командный-файл способен проверять параметры выполнения а-также отвечать при ошибки.
Контроль исключений помогает предотвратить прерывания запуска плюс обеспечивает устойчивую эксплуатацию. Сценарий имеет-возможность отобразить предупреждение, записать ошибку к системную-запись или провести резервное операцию. Подобная-логика формирует сценарии значительно надежной а-также предсказуемой.
Грамотная настройка над ошибками в-частности значима в развитых сценариях, когда подключено большое-количество элементов. Контроль сбоев дает-возможность поддержать корректность данных плюс правильность завершения операций 1xbet зеркало.